Hospice care is care at the end of life that emphasizes relief of symptoms and provides emotional, spiritual, and social support for a dying person and family members. The setting may be the person’s home, a hospice facility, or another institution, such as a nursing home. Hospice-type care is provided in some hospitals.

Time to death after ingesting the lethal drugs seems highly unpredictable. Of cases with available data in Oregon since 2001, time from drug ingestion to death has ranged from 1 min (too short for the cause to have been oral drugs) to 108 h. Thirty-three percent of the total deaths with recorded data have taken over an hour, and 7.6% over 6 h.Sep 1, 2019 ... Retrospective population-level cohort study of all decedents in Ontario, Canada, from April 1, 2011 to March 31, 2015 who received a home care assessment in the last 30 days of life ( n = 20,349). Severe daily pain in the last 30 days of life using linked Ontario health administrative databases.
